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: 1. 18-80 years old; 2.Venous stenosis of autologous arteriovenous fistula, with stenosis >=50%, and at least one clinical, physiological, or hemodynamic abnormality attributable to stenosis as defined in the KDOQI guidelines; 3.A single stenotic lesion, which can be a primary stenosis or a recurrent stenosis after PTA treatment; 4.Voluntarily participate in this study and sign the informed consent form.If the subject is unable to read and sign the informed consent due to incapacity or other reasons, the guardian shall act as the agent for the informed process and sign the informed consent. If the subject does not have the ability to read the informed consent (illiterate subject), a witness must witness the informed process and sign the informed consent.

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: 1. stenosis can not be fully expanded; 2.PTA thrombosis in short time; 3. Patients with concurrent stent implantation in DCB; 4. Life expectancy of subjects <12 months; 5.Vulnerable groups in addition to illiteracy, including people with mental illness, people with cognitive impairment, critically ill patients, minors, pregnant women, etc.
